* **Performance**: SQLite is not as fast as MySQL or PostgreSQL, especially when using complex queries or many users.
|
||||
* **Emulated RegEx search**: SQLite does not support RegEx search natively. Part-DB can emulate it, however that is pretty slow.
|
||||
* **Emualted natural sorting**: SQLite does not support natural sorting natively. Part-DB can emulate it, but it is pretty slow.
|
||||
* **Emulated natural sorting**: SQLite does not support natural sorting natively. Part-DB can emulate it, but it is pretty slow.
|
||||
* **Limitations with Unicode**: SQLite has limitations in comparisons and sorting of Unicode characters, which might lead to
|
||||
unexpected behavior when using non-ASCII characters in your data. For example `µ` (micro sign) is not seen as equal to
|
||||
`μ` (greek minuscule mu), therefore searching for `µ` (micro sign) will not find parts containing `μ` (mu) and vice versa.

## KiCad Integration Issues
|
||||
|
||||
### "API responded with error code: 0: Unknown"
|
||||
|
||||
If you get this error when trying to connect KiCad to Part-DB, it is most likely caused by KiCad not trusting your SSL/TLS certificate.
|
||||
|
||||
**Cause:** KiCad does not trust self-signed SSL/TLS certificates.
|
||||
|
||||
**Solutions:**
|
||||
- Use HTTP instead of HTTPS for the `root_url` in your KiCad library configuration (only recommended for local networks)
|
||||
- Use a certificate from a trusted Certificate Authority (CA) like [Let's Encrypt](https://letsencrypt.org/)
|
||||
- Add your self-signed certificate to the system's trusted certificate store on the computer running KiCad (the exact steps depend on your operating system)
|
||||
|
||||
For more information about KiCad integration, see the [EDA / KiCad integration](../usage/eda_integration.md) documentation.
